Bayek, also known by the alias Amun, is indeed the co-founder of the Hidden Ones, alongside his wife Aya of Alexandria, marking the beginning of the organization that would eventually evolve into the Assassin Brotherhood. The foundation of the Hidden Ones by Bayek and Aya was a pivotal moment in the Assassin’s Creed universe, driven by their desire to protect the people of Egypt from oppression and injustice.

Introduction to Bayek and the Hidden Ones

Background and Motivation

The story of Bayek and the inception of the Hidden Ones is deeply intertwined with the events of Assassin’s Creed Origins. Bayek, a Medjay from the village of Siwa, dedicated his life to protecting his people, following in the footsteps of his father, Sabu. The tragic death of his son, Khemu, at the hands of the Order of the Ancients, sets Bayek and Aya on a path of vengeance and ultimately leads to the establishment of the Hidden Ones.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Did Bayek Create the Hidden Ones?

Bayek, alongside his wife Aya, is credited with the foundation of the Hidden Ones, which served as the precursor to the Assassin Brotherhood.

2. Who is the Founder of the Hidden Ones?

The Hidden Ones were founded by Bayek of Siwa and his wife Aya of Alexandria in 47 BCE, with the primary goal of safeguarding the people’s freedom and protecting them from oppression.

3. Did Bayek and Aya Start the Assassins?

Yes, Bayek and Aya are considered the founders of the first major organization of assassins, which would later evolve into the Assassin Brotherhood.

4. Is Bayek the Founder of the Creed?

As the co-founder of the Hidden Ones, Bayek is essentially the first Assassin of his kind, laying the groundwork for the Assassin’s Creed.

5. Why Did Bayek Create the Hidden Ones?

The creation of the Hidden Ones was a direct response to the Order of the Ancients and their brutal actions, including the murder of Bayek’s son, which drove Bayek and Aya to seek justice and protect their people.

6. Is Bayek Mentioned in Valhalla?

Bayek makes a brief appearance in Assassin’s Creed Valhalla through a voiceover when the protagonist Eivor discovers the Magas Codex.

7. Why Did Aya Divorce Bayek?

Aya and Bayek’s relationship ends due to the loss of their son and the realization that their love was lost with his death, leading Aya to inform Bayek of their separation.

8. Who Was the First Assassin in Real Life?

Hassan-i-Sabbah is often considered one of the first historical figures associated with the concept of assassins, founding the Order of Assassins in the Middle East.

9. Did Aya Really Love Bayek?

The relationship between Bayek and Aya is depicted as deep and loving, with the two having grown up together and eventually becoming a couple.

10. Did Bayek Create the Brotherhood?

Bayek, alongside Aya, is the co-founder of the Hidden Ones, which later evolves into the Assassin Brotherhood.

11. What Happened to Bayek After Origins?

Bayek’s mummified remains are found by Layla, who extracts his genetic memories to relive them in the Animus, indicating that Bayek had passed away.

12. How Did the Hidden Ones Become Assassins?

The transformation of the Hidden Ones into the Assassin Brotherhood is attributed to the influence of Hassan Sabbah, who initiated a reformation movement within the organization.

13. Did Aya and Bayek Break Up?

Yes, Aya and Bayek decide to go their separate ways after completing their cycle of vengeance, marking the end of their relationship.

14. Is Bayek Actually an Assassin?

Initially, Bayek is portrayed as a Medjay rather than an Assassin, but his actions and the foundation of the Hidden Ones align with the principles of the Assassin Brotherhood.

15. Is Bayek an Ancestor of Layla?

While Bayek, Kassandra, and Alexios are all connected through the Assassin’s Creed storyline, Layla is not directly related to them but is instead the protagonist who explores their memories through the Animus.
